    The nice guys at the Freeway Designs home office in Taipei. Where nice enough to send me a sample of one of their latest products the FWD-P3C4XD for review.

    This board features dual socket 370 processors, AGP Pro, onboard sound, and a sexy red PCB. That is to not mention a variety of core voltages and FSB to 166 MHz.
